Tajikistan is a country located in Central Asia, known for its rich culture and delicious cuisine. Tajikistani recipes are a fusion of Persian, Russian, and Uzbek influences, creating a unique and flavorful experience. In this food category, we explore some of the most popular and traditional Tajikistani recipes that will tantalize your taste buds.

First on the list is the Kabab Sauce, a spicy and tangy sauce that is perfect for marinating meat. This sauce is made with a blend of tomatoes, onions, garlic, and a variety of spices, including cumin, coriander, and paprika. The Kabab Sauce is a staple in Tajikistani cuisine and is often paired with grilled meats, such as lamb, beef, or chicken.

Next up is the Sabse Borani, a creamy yogurt dip that is infused with garlic and mint. This dip is a popular appetizer in Tajikistan and is often served with bread or crackers. The Sabse Borani is not only delicious but also healthy, as it is packed with probiotics and essential nutrients.

Another popular sauce in Tajikistan is the Korma Sauce, a rich and flavorful sauce made with a blend of spices, including cinnamon, cardamom, and nutmeg. This sauce is typically used in meat and vegetable dishes and is known for its warm and comforting flavor.

For those who love herbs, the Coriander Sauce is a must-try. This sauce is made with fresh coriander leaves, garlic, and yogurt, creating a tangy and herbaceous flavor. The Coriander Sauce is often used as a dip for vegetables or as a spread for sandwiches.

Tajikistan Bread with Spinach is a delicious and healthy bread that is made with spinach and a variety of spices, including cumin and coriander. This bread is perfect for breakfast or as a side dish for a hearty meal.

Finally, we have Hawayej, a spice blend that is commonly used in Tajikistani cuisine. This blend is made with a variety of spices, including cumin, coriander, and cardamom, and is often used in meat and vegetable dishes.
